1. 首页 > MySQL教程 > 正文

AI时代-传统DBA与自动化DBA的差距与未来(AI-DBA自动化运维之MySQL DBA系列)

六、根据AI发展趋势,51CTO风哥推出了<<AI-DBA自动化运维之MySQL DBA系列>>课程:

(00)AI自动化运维开发快速入门

(01)MySQL9.7/8.4数据库安装配置自动化

(02)MySQL9.7/8.4多实例安装配置自动化

(03)MySQL9.7/8.4主从复制集群安装配置自动化

(04)MySQL9.7/8.4 MGR组复制集群安装配置自动化

(05)MySQL9.7/8.4 InnoDB Cluster集群安装布署自动化

(06)MySQL9.7数据库自动备份恢复与升级迁移

(07)MySQL9.7性能分析与故障诊断智能化

学习地址:https://edu.51cto.com/topic/6832.html

学习本专题内容后,简历上增加一条:

有一定的Shell/Python基础,具备通过AI实现数据库日常自动化工具开发的基本能力。

现阶段已现实以下自动化工具的开发与应用:

1)MySQL8.4/9.7数据库单机、单机多实例、主从复制、MGR、InnoDBCluster集群的自动化快速安装布署。

2)MySQL8.4/9.7自动化备份、参数优化、慢查询分析、长事务分析、日志分析与挖掘、空间预测、锁分析、性能分析、SQL审核、SQL优化、故障处理、每日/每月自动巡检、自动化邮件通知等。

3)更多数据库自动化工具正在研究开发中…

AI 正在快速淘汰”纯手工”DBA,同时催生自动化DBA新岗位:两者在技能、效率、薪资、职业天花板上已出现明显代差;未来 3-5 年,不会用 AI 的传统 DBA 将面临边缘化甚至被替代的风险,下面以互联网金领岗位MySQL DBA为案例说明:

严格聚焦自动化MySQL DBA(核心:脚本化、平台化、运维自动化,而非AI大模型),做真实、落地的技术对比、薪资拆解和职业未来分析,这是当前企业最主流、最刚需的DBA岗位方向。

核心定义先明确

– 传统MySQL DBA:纯手工运维,靠命令行、经验、人肉操作完成数据库日常工作,无标准化、无自动化平台。

– 自动化MySQL DBA:以代码化、平台化、自动化为核心,用工具+脚本+平台替代90%重复手工操作,专注架构、稳定性、高可用。

 

一、真实技术差距(最核心、企业最看重)

1.1 日常工作模式对比

传统MySQL DBA(手工/人肉运维,70%重复运维 + 30%救火 ,效率极低,人多就乱)

1. 部署:手动安装MySQL、手动改配置、手动搭建主从/主从切换,一台实例耗时1~2小时,易出错。

2. 监控:简单脚本+人工查看,告警靠人盯,故障后被动救火。

3. 备份恢复:手动写定时任务、手动校验备份、恢复全靠手工执行。

4. 变更/巡检:逐台服务器执行SQL、逐台核对状态,纯体力劳动。

5. 故障处理:凭经验排查,无标准化流程,耗时久、不可复现。

6. 上限:单人最多维护 20~30个实例,精力全被重复工作消耗。

自动化MySQL DBA(平台/代码运维,20%日常运维 + 80%架构/稳定性/效率建设,效率极高,支持规模化集群管理)

1. 部署:基于自研的一键部署,10分钟完成一套高可用架构,配置标准化。

2. 监控:全自动化监控,告警自动分级、自动通知,无需盯屏。

3. 备份恢复:自动化备份、自动校验、自动清理,支持一键恢复,无人值守。

4. 变更/巡检:批量自动化执行、自动巡检、自动生成报告,0手工操作。

5. 故障处理:自动故障检测、自动主从切换、自动限流止损,MTTR(故障恢复时间)缩短80%。

6. 上限:单人轻松维护 100~300个实例,精力聚焦架构优化。

1.2. 效率与价值差距(企业最直观)

1. 操作效率:自动化DBA效率是传统DBA的 5~10倍;

2. 故障风险:手工操作故障率10%~20%,自动化操作故障率<1%;

3. 人力成本:维护100实例,传统DBA需要3~5人,自动化DBA仅需1人;

4. 业务价值:传统DBA是成本岗,自动化DBA是稳定性保障+效率提升的核心岗。

二、真实薪资差距(国内一线城市,数据仅供参考,来自AI分析)

1.AI分析薪资变化趋势:传统DBA薪资(一线城市)

2025年:20-30K/月

2027年:18-25K/月(下降10-20%)

2030年:15-20K/月(下降25-30%)

2033年:12-18K/月(下降40%)

2.AI分析薪资变化趋势:自动化DBA薪资(一线城市):

2025年:25-35K/月

2027年:30-45K/月(增长20-30%)

2030年:40-60K/月(增长60-70%)

2033年:50-80K/月(增长100%+)

核心结论:

自动化DBA = 传统DBA薪资 + 20%~100%溢价

高级岗位差距更大,自动化DBA更容易进入技术管理、架构师通道。

三、未来3~5年职业走向(最现实)

1. 传统MySQL DBA 未来

1)低端手工岗(1-3年):2~3年内被自动化工具/云数据库RDS直接替代,岗位大量消失;

2)中级经验岗(3-5年):不转型自动化,只能留在传统企业、小公司,薪资停滞、裁员优先;

3)高端专家岗:仅少量留存于金融、政企核心系统,但必须兼容自动化能力,纯手工无生存空间。

一句话总结:纯传统MySQL DBA,正在快速被淘汰。

2. 自动化MySQL DBA 未来

1)刚需长期存在:云数据库无法覆盖所有场景,私有化、混合云、自建集群必须依赖自动化DBA;

2)职业路径清晰

自动化DBA → 数据库架构师 → 数据平台负责人 → 技术总监

3)不可替代性强:自动化不但会要求写脚本写工具做产品,还要做到架构设计+故障治理+效率平台+高可用保障,是企业核心技术岗;

4)与AI协同:AI是辅助工具,自动化是底座,未来是自动化+AI增强,而非AI替代自动化。

一句话总结:自动化MySQL DBA是DBA岗位的主流标配、长期刚需、高天花板方向。

四、企业招聘真实要求(直接对标简历/能力)

1)传统DBA招聘要求

– 熟悉MySQL安装、主从、备份恢复

– 能处理慢查询、基础故障

– 能做日常巡检、数据迁移

2)自动化DBA招聘要求(企业高频关键词)

– 熟悉MySQL安装、主从、备份恢复、性能优化、故障处理等日常维护工作

– 精通Shell/Python至少一种,能写自动化脚本,熟悉自动化工具

– 有数据库自动化平台、监控平台、变更平台搭建经验

– 能支撑大规模实例(100+)自动化运维

五、最终总结

1. 技术差距

传统DBA = 手工运维,自动化DBA = 平台+代码+标准化,效率差距 5~10倍。

2. 薪资差距

自动化DBA比传统DBA高 30%~100%,高级岗位年薪差距可达 40万以上。

3. 未来差距

传统DBA逐步被替代/边缘化;

自动化MySQL DBA是DBA职业的唯一主流未来,安全、稳定、高价值、高天花板。

(注:文档部分内容的分析可能由 AI 生成,请认真辨别!)

本文由风哥教程整理发布,仅用于学习测试使用,转载注明出处:http://www.fgedu.net.cn/10327.html

联系我们

在线咨询:点击这里给我发消息

微信号:itpux-com

工作日:9:30-18:30,节假日休息